Entrepreneurial intentions of high school students with neurodevelopmental disorders: Implications for career transition

Chiedu Eseadi    

Resumen

The purpose of the study was to determine entrepreneurial intentions of high school students with neurodevelopmental disorders. Descriptive research design was adopted for the study. The sample comprised of 150 college students with neurodevelopmental disorders. A questionnaire was used for data collection. The findings of the study show that attitude, subjective norm and perceived behavioural norm have a significant influence on entrepreneurial intentions of high school students with neurodevelopmental disorders. The following recommendation was given based on the study's findings: all the stakeholders such as government agency, policy makers, school authorities, and parents should create enabling environment that will help the students develop positive attitude and mindset towards entrepreneurship.
